About this book:

Chicken From its origins as the wild Red Junglefowl of Southeast Asia to its status as the most numerous domesticated bird on the planet and a cornerstone of global nutrition, the chicken's journey with humanity is a remarkable tale. More than just a food source, the chicken is a creature of fascinating biology, complex social dynamics, and deep cultural significance. This comprehensive guide explores everything about the chicken, delving into its history, tracing its spread across the world with human migration and trade, and revealing how centuries of selective breeding have resulted in an astonishing diversity of breeds, from prolific egg layers and fast-growing meat birds to hardy heritage fowl and striking ornamental varieties.

Beyond breed characteristics, this book examines the varied ways chickens are raised today, from small-scale backyard flocks to large-scale industrial operations, discussing the biology, health, and welfare considerations inherent in different farming systems, including free-range and pasture-raised alternatives. It covers the science behind chicken health, nutrition, and vaccination, explains the intricate processes of egg formation and meat production, and details the critical steps involved in processing and ensuring food safety from farm to table. Ultimately, it considers the environmental impact of chicken production, their rich symbolic roles in culture and folklore, the challenges facing the industry today, and the exciting future of sustainability, welfare, and innovation in the world of chickens.
